Company overview

Enterprise Health is a leading provider of occupational health and employee health IT solutions, serving a diverse range of industries including healthcare, manufacturing, and government sectors. They generate revenue by offering comprehensive software platforms that integrate occupational health, employee health, and compliance management, enabling organizations to streamline processes and improve health outcomes. The company has a strong history of innovation, being one of the few vendors that provide a single solution for both occupational and employee health records, which is crucial for organizations aiming to maintain regulatory compliance and enhance workforce productivity.
